Having the right hairstyle can really complete a Halloween costume, and backcombing is the key to creepily crazy hair – the bigger the better! This isn’t about gentle teasing to give your hair a little lift, Halloween is about extreme volume, messy tresses and LOTS of hairspray. Want to rock a hair-raising look yourself? Here’s our guide to recreating some scarily big Halloween hair:

You will need:

  • Crimping iron
  • Brush
  • Comb
  • Hair pins
  • Supersoft Maximum Hold Hairspray

To begin, brush through your hair and then separate it into sections.
Spray each section with Supersoft Maximum Hold Hairspray to give the hair some texture.
Next, divide your hair into 1-2inch sections and crimp from root to tip. Repeat until all the hair is crimped.

Use your comb to backcomb 1-2inch sections of crimped hair to create the big volume this style requires. Spray each section generously with got2b glued blasting freeze spray.
Once you have reached the volume you require, simply add the finishing touches by teasing your hair into place, securing a few sections with hair pins if necessary.
